On my main character I have 100% completion, and I spent hours alt+tabbing to maps on websites and back to the game to see where something is, what I missed, or how to get somewhere. My suggestion is that instead of hiding the map by default for every new character, reveal all the previously explored areas from any character. I’m NOT saying auto complete the maps, I’m saying reveal the POIs, vistas, SPs, waypoints, and map details such as towns or paths, etc, but still have them on zero completion for the characters that have yet to do them. It seems pointless to have to rediscover areas already discovered, and totally unnecessary to have to go through the tedious hassle of alt tabbing a million times for each new character just to find out where you want to go.

If it is too hard to code this type of communication inside all the accounts, why not make an NPC that sells account bound map unlocks to characters with 100%? The 100% character can buy it, then bank it. Then the new character on the same account can consume it, and have the areas explored. If this takes the fun out of the game for someone(I consider it dreadful, not fun. I find re-exploring to be the BIGGEST turn-off of playing a new character), it is totally optional. Once against I’m saying to only reveal map details such as where things are and show paths, etc, so that the entire map isn’t a giant blur. I’m not saying to auto-complete hearts, POIs, vistas, SPs, and waypoints.
